Vue的data、computed、watch源码如何改写为长尾关键词?

2026-04-03 09:130阅读0评论SEO资源
  • 内容介绍
  • 文章标签
  • 相关推荐

本文共计2610个文字,预计阅读时间需要11分钟。

Vue的data、computed、watch源码如何改写为长尾关键词?

阅读并记录初学Vue源码的时刻,在defineReactive、Observer、Dep、Watcher等内部设计源码间穿梭,发现其中再无谜团。Vue历经多年发展,经历多次fix和feature的添加,内部源码愈发庞大而复杂。

导读

记得初学Vue源码的时候,在defineReactive、Observer、Dep、Watcher等等内部设计源码之间跳来跳去,发现再也绕不出来了。Vue发展了很久,很多fix和feature的增加让内部源码越来越庞大,太多的边界情况和优化设计掩盖了原本精简的代码设计,让新手阅读源码变得越来越困难,但是面试的时候,Vue的响应式原理几乎成了Vue技术栈的公司面试中高级前端必问的点之一。

这篇文章通过自己实现一个响应式系统,尽量还原和Vue内部源码同样结构,但是剔除掉和渲染、优化等等相关的代码,来最低成本的学习Vue的响应式原理。

阅读全文

本文共计2610个文字,预计阅读时间需要11分钟。

Vue的data、computed、watch源码如何改写为长尾关键词?

阅读并记录初学Vue源码的时刻,在defineReactive、Observer、Dep、Watcher等内部设计源码间穿梭,发现其中再无谜团。Vue历经多年发展,经历多次fix和feature的添加,内部源码愈发庞大而复杂。

导读

记得初学Vue源码的时候,在defineReactive、Observer、Dep、Watcher等等内部设计源码之间跳来跳去,发现再也绕不出来了。Vue发展了很久,很多fix和feature的增加让内部源码越来越庞大,太多的边界情况和优化设计掩盖了原本精简的代码设计,让新手阅读源码变得越来越困难,但是面试的时候,Vue的响应式原理几乎成了Vue技术栈的公司面试中高级前端必问的点之一。

这篇文章通过自己实现一个响应式系统,尽量还原和Vue内部源码同样结构,但是剔除掉和渲染、优化等等相关的代码,来最低成本的学习Vue的响应式原理。

阅读全文